TABLE 1: Job openings estimated rate and level changes between January 2019 and February 2019, and test of significance, seasonally adjusted Rates Levels (in thousands) ===== ===================== Estimated Minimum Pass test of Estimated Minimum Pass test of over-the-month significant significance over-the-month significant significance Industry and region change change* change change* Total nonfarm -0.3 0.2 YES -538 281 YES INDUSTRY Total private -0.3 0.2 YES -523 276 YES Mining and logging (1) -1.2 1.0 YES -10 8 YES Construction (1) -0.3 0.8 -27 58 Manufacturing 0.2 0.3 19 42 Durable goods (1) 0.2 0.4 13 31 Nondurable goods (1) 0.1 0.5 6 24 Trade, transportation, and utilities -0.6 0.4 YES -160 108 YES Wholesale trade -0.9 0.7 YES -53 42 YES Retail trade -0.3 0.5 -41 81 Transportation, warehousing, and utilities (1) -1.0 0.8 YES -66 46 YES Information (1) -0.3 0.7 -11 22 Financial activities -1.2 0.7 YES -113 63 YES Finance and insurance -0.6 0.8 -40 52 Real estate and rental and leasing (1) -2.9 1.1 YES -72 24 YES Professional and business services -0.2 0.7 -51 132 Education and health services -0.4 0.4 -105 97 YES Educational services (1) -0.6 0.5 YES -23 19 YES Health care and social assistance -0.3 0.5 -81 94 Leisure and hospitality -0.6 0.6 -105 101 YES Arts, entertainment, and recreation -0.1 1.0 -3 25 Accommodation and food services -0.6 0.6 -103 94 YES Other services 0.6 1.0 40 60 Government -0.1 0.2 -15 46 Federal (1) -0.3 0.3 -10 10 State and local 0.0 0.2 -5 44 State and local education 0.0 0.2 -3 18 State and local, excluding education -0.1 0.3 -2 33 REGION Northeast -0.3 0.4 -112 109 YES South -0.3 0.3 -188 171 YES Midwest -0.4 0.4 -172 119 YES West -0.2 0.4 -66 130 (1) No regular seasonal movements could be identified in this series, therefore, the seasonally adjusted and not seasonally adjusted data are identical. SOURCE: Bureau of Labor Statistics, Job Openings and Labor Turnover Survey, April 9, 2019. *NOTE: Significant over-the-month changes are calculated at a 90-percent confidence level. The median standard error is used in testing the over-the-month change.
